    I received my voting form today. I did have card protection and Identity protection policies, but only got one voting form!

    I called CPP as I was expecting a voting form for each policy. But I was told I only needed one voting form for both policies, as my covering letter had quoted both policy numbers and this was bar coded into the voting form! Another bit of confusion as I had read one vote form per policy!

    Also one of my policies started in 2001 and I was told to contact the original provider to claim for those years 2001-2005.

    What is rather worrying is "this claiming/voting" process seems a little too easy, if it is approved. Usually you have to fight to get any compensation, which is a long drawn out process! Why are they making it easy (for some of us)????
